在主要基因相容性复合体内,精神分裂症的常见风险等位基因预测白质微观结构
Xavier Caseras1, Emily Simmonds2,3, Antonio F Pardiñas2
1Centre for Neuropsychiatric Genetics and Genomics, Department of Psychological Medicine and Clinical Neurosciences, Cardiff University, Cardiff, UK. CaserasX@cardiff.ac.uk.
补充基因中的常见风险变异,特别是主要基因相容性综合体,与大脑白质微观结构的改变有关,这表明精神分裂症的神经生物学机制.

背景情况:
- 补充基因在大脑发育和精神分裂症风险方面发挥着作用.
- 精神分裂症与白质微观结构的改变有关.
研究的目的:
- 研究补充基因中的精神分裂症风险变异与前额叶连接的通道中的白质微观结构之间的关联.
- 确定受这些风险变异影响的特定基因组区域和微观结构指标.
主要方法:
- 在补充基因和基因间区域内分析常见的风险变异.
- 与扩散张力成像 (DTI) 度量相关,特别是轴突密度和方向分散指数.
- 专注于连接额叶皮层与其他大脑区域的白质道.
主要成果:
- 补充基因组和基因间区域内的风险等位基因显著预测了轴突密度.
- 染色体6上的主要基因相容性复合体 (MHC) 区域被确定为这些关联的关键驱动因素.
- 对于方向分散指数,没有发现显著的关联,表明轴突包装的变化,但不表明一致性.
结论:
- 在MHC区域内的常见风险等位基因,包括与补体相关的变异,影响特定白质道中的轴突包装.
- 改变的轴突包装是一种潜在的神经生物学机制,是精神分裂症风险的基础.
- 这些发现提供了关于精神分裂症和大脑发育的遗传结构的见解.
